Vicarious Parenting: A Growing Trend in Modern Society

In today’s fast-paced world, the concept of parenting is continually evolving, with new trends emerging that reshape the traditional notions of child-rearing. One such trend that has gained considerable attention in recent years is vicarious parenting. This unique approach, which involves individuals without biological or legal connections to children actively taking on parental roles, has sparked numerous debates and discussions.

Vicarious parenting can take many forms, ranging from extended family members, close friends, or even hired caregivers assuming significant caregiving responsibilities. It is often driven by various factors such as the unavailability of biological parents due to work commitments, geographic distance, or other personal circumstances.

Proponents argue that vicarious parenting provides children with alternative role models and a wide range of experiences, enhancing their social development. Having multiple caregivers allows children to gain diverse perspectives, fostering creative problem-solving skills and healthy emotional intelligence.

However, critics of this approach raise concerns about its potential impact on a child’s sense of stability and attachment. They argue that consistent caregiving from primary parental figures is crucial for a child’s emotional well-being and secure attachment formation.

In reality, vicarious parenting can be both valuable and challenging. It requires careful planning, clear communication, and a willingness to adapt. Open dialogue between all parties involved is essential to ensure that the child’s best interests are consistently prioritized.

Conclusion

As society continues to change, so too does our understanding of what constitutes effective parenting. Vicarious parenting, although relatively new, offers an alternative model that has its merits and challenges. Ultimately, it is up to each family to assess their unique circumstances and determine what type of caregiving arrangement best suits their child’s needs. Whether it be biological, adoptive, or vicarious, what truly matters is providing a nurturing environment where children can thrive and grow into well-rounded individuals.
